HIP 103723
HIP 103723 is a G-type (Yellow) star.
Located approximately 330.8 light-years from Earth, HIP 103723 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 103723 is classified as a spectral class G star (G-type (Yellow)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 103723 has an apparent magnitude of +9.37,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its yellow-white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.665.
